AKRON, Ohio - Akron Police Detectives are asking for the public's help in locating a suspected First Merit bank robber.
Detectives were able to identify last Friday's bank robber through physical evidence and signed a warrant for robbery on Ralphel Antonio Penn, 25, of Cox Drive in Stow, Ohio.
Now, Akron Police are asking for the public's help locating Penn. He's described as a black male, 5'08", 155 lbs.
On August 17, Penn entered the First Merit Bank located at 840 Brittain Road around 11 a.m. He handed the teller a note demanding money, then fled the scene with an undisclosed amount of cash.
Detectives believe Penn may also be responsible for two other bank robberies, one in Northfield Village and the other in Solon, Ohio.
Additional charges are expected.
